I am replacing my head unit in my 02 Maxima. I have searched the diagrams posted here for the stereo wiring but did not see the wire I am looking for.

There is a purple w/ red wire that goes from pin 22 of the stereo to pin 13 of the unified meter control. With the head unit out, I have no trip computer function. What is the purpose (switched 12volts, ground) of this wire?

BOSE.....you need to get a proper adapter for it. Look at peripherals SVEN4 (55.00) and the plug you need is the SVHNI2 (15.00) This allows you to integrate an aftermarket deck with the factory Bose stuff. Other wise you have alot of work to do!
